[MS.Build] ProjectInstance needs ChildrenReversed to evaluate items.
authorAtsushi Eno <atsushieno@gmail.com>
Thu, 29 May 2014 09:29:00 +0000 (18:29 +0900)
committerAtsushi Eno <atsushieno@gmail.com>
Mon, 2 Jun 2014 08:58:48 +0000 (17:58 +0900)
commitf2d143e6c39248d0226e0767230ca51633f49e21
treecb97df7ba66f348e4dc1a8b8bd61926f01076afa
parentce1d55ff605e56241d56ab4bdecf34c246b38e65
[MS.Build] ProjectInstance needs ChildrenReversed to evaluate items.

This behavioral difference between ProjectRootElement, Project and
ProjectInstance was discovered while trying to get F# project working
(where item order significantly matters).
mcs/class/Microsoft.Build/Microsoft.Build.Execution/ProjectInstance.cs